According to the Center for Mind-Body Medicine, stress has been shown to be a contributing factor in 80% of illnesses. It inhibits healing and recovering from illnesses. Stress can effect your health in many ways, such as:
- Immune System: Stress on the immune system causes physiological changes that tend to weaken the system so infections and illnesses occur more frequently.
- Cardiovascular System: Chronic stress can result in high blood pressure, atherosclerosis, strokes, heart attacks, and other cardiovascular system disorders.
- Nervous System: The human nervous system responds to stress in many different ways. Some people may develop migraine headaches, while others suffer from sleep deprivation or chronic fatigue.
